Mark Dion (politician)


Mark N. Dion is an American politician, law enforcement officer and lawyer from Maine. Dion, a Democrat, was elected Sheriff of Cumberland County, Maine in 1998. Re-elected in 2002 and 2006, Dion chose not to seek re-election as Sheriff in 2010. Instead, he successfully sought a seat in the Maine House of Representatives. In 2013, Dion was named Chair of the Criminal Justice and Public Safety Committee.
Dion ran for Governor of Maine in 2018, placing fifth in the Democratic Party primary.

Education

Dion earned a B.A. in criminal justice at the University of Southern Maine, a M.A. in human services administration from Antioch College and a J.D. from the University of Maine School of Law.
